Crown Repair

Crown repair in Idylwood is often the most urgent work we do. The concrete crown at the top of your chimney is its only defense against water intrusion, and on chimneys built in the 1950s and 1960s, that crown has endured 60-70 years of Northern Virginia freeze-thaw cycling. We see the worst deterioration on north- and east-facing chimney faces, where morning sun never fully dries the masonry before the next cold night. Our crown repair process begins with a camera inspection to document the extent of water damage below the crown line. We then remove loose material, apply a bonding agent, and rebuild with professional-grade crown mix formulated for our climate. For Idylwood chimneys with minor cracking but sound structure, we also offer HeatShield crown coating as a preventive measure.

Custom Cap Fabrication

Standard box-store caps don’t fit Idylwood’s older chimneys well. Many postwar flues are oversized for modern inserts, or the chimney has an unusual dimension from a decades-ago modification. We measure on site and fabricate custom caps from stainless steel or copper, sized to your exact flue opening and overhang. A proper custom cap for an Idylwood chimney does more than keep rain out. It creates the correct draft dynamics for a flue that may already be marginal. Multi-Flue Cap Installation

Multi-flue caps cover two or more flue openings with a single hooded structure. They’re ideal for Idylwood homes where the original chimney served both a basement furnace and an upstairs fireplace, or where a later addition created a second flue. The key advantage is unified protection: one cap eliminates the gaps between separate covers where water and debris collect. We install multi-flue caps from Olympia Chimney and Gelco with spark-arrestor mesh and proper clearance to all flue walls. For Idylwood’s repurposed oil-furnace flues, a multi-flue cap can also improve draft by creating a warmer column of air above the flue opening.

Cap Replacement

Cap replacement sounds simple until you’ve seen what a poorly fitted cap does to a chimney over five years. We replace rusted, wind-damaged, or improperly installed caps throughout Idylwood. Every replacement starts with measurement and inspection of the flue tile condition beneath the old cap. If the flue is cracked or the liner is failing, we’ll show you the camera image and explain your options before installing a new cap on damaged infrastructure. Our replacement caps are fabricated from 24-gauge stainless or copper, never galvanized steel that will rust through in our humid Piedmont climate.

Crown Coating

Crown coating with HeatShield is a preventive treatment for Idylwood chimneys showing early-stage cracking but no structural spalling. We apply a flexible, waterproof membrane that bridges hairline cracks and sheds water while allowing the crown to breathe. This isn’t a substitute for rebuilding a failed crown. It is a cost-effective way to extend the life of sound concrete that’s beginning to show its age. We recommend it for Idylwood homeowners whose Level 2 inspection shows minor crown deterioration but no water intrusion into the firebox yet.

Common Chimney Cap & Crown Problems We See in Idylwood Homes

  • Spalling mortar on north-facing exposures. Idylwood’s chimneys built between 1950 and 1970 have mortar joints that never fully dry on shaded sides. Repeated freeze-thaw cycles through Northern Virginia winters pop the face off bricks and erode joints until water runs straight into the firebox. We catch this with camera inspection before the damage requires rebuild rather than repointing.
  • Repurposed oil-furnace flues operating as wood-burning fireplaces. This is the signature Idylwood failure pattern. The oversized flue stays cold, draws poorly, and deposits heavy glazed creosote just above the smoke chamber even when the homeowner burns only a cord or two per season. A proper cap or multi-flue cover helps, but the real fix is usually a correctly sized liner plus cap combination.
  • Cracked chimney crowns letting water past the flue tile. Original crowns from the 1950s and 1960s were often poured with inadequate reinforcement and a flat or improperly sloped top. Water pools, freezes, and cracks the crown. Once water reaches the clay flue liner, freeze-thaw splits the tiles and opens a path into the chimney structure. We document this progression with photos you can see.
  • Rusted dampers and firebox components from chronic moisture. When the cap is missing or the crown is cracked, Idylwood’s humid Piedmont climate keeps the chimney interior damp through spring and fall. Rusted dampers don’t seal or open properly. We inspect the damper assembly during every cap and crown evaluation and show you the condition before recommending repair.

Pricing for Chimney Cap & Crown in Idylwood, VA

Here is what cap and crown work typically costs in the Idylwood market. Every job begins with a Level 2 camera inspection ($189-$240, credited toward repair if you proceed). We do not recommend work without showing you the photos.

Service Typical Range in Idylwood
Standard stainless cap installation $280-$450
Custom cap (stainless or copper) $480-$750
Multi-flue cap installation $550-$890
Crown coating (HeatShield) $340-$520
Crown repair / partial rebuild $620-$1,200
Full crown replacement $1,100-$1,800

Factors that move the price: accessibility (steep roof pitch, multiple stories), extent of water damage beneath the crown, whether flue tile repair or relining is needed before capping, and custom fabrication for non-standard flue dimensions.
